Central Cabarrus picks up 21st straight win at home

By Team Reports Jan 9, 2024, 5:14pm

Recap: Central Cabarrus Vikings vs. Northwest Cabarrus Trojans

The Central Cabarrus Vikings put another one in the bag on Wednesday to keep their perfect season alive. They blew past Northwest Cabarrus 78-35 at home. Central Cabarrus might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team's won 11 games by 21 points or more this season.

Central Cabarrus had a senior duo take command as Chase Daniel scored 19 points along with six assists and six steals and Desmond Kent Jr. scored 24 points. The matchup was Kent Jr.'s 12th in a row with at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Josh Dalton, who scored 12 points along with six rebounds and five blocks.

Several Trojans players turned in solid performances, despite ultimately coming up short. Perhaps the best among those players was Jordan Gonder, who scored 12 points. Ezekiel Brown was another key contributor, scoring six points along with seven rebounds.

Central Cabarrus pushed their record up to 12-0 with that victory, which was their 21st straight at home dating back to last season. Those victories were due in large part to their offensive dominance across that stretch, as they averaged 90.8 points per game. As for Northwest Cabarrus, their loss dropped their record down to 7-5.

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Central Cabarrus will take on West Rowan at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. West Rowan is strutting with some offensive muscle, as they've averaged 64.3 points per game. As for Northwest Cabarrus, they will be playing at home against East Rowan at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. East Rowan will have to bring their A-game into this one, as they are staring down a pretty big deficit in the MaxPreps North Carolina Rankings (they are ranked 549th, while Northwest Cabarrus is ranked 187th).
